Outbreak/Illness Investigations

Canada: CFIA reports that an investigation is underway an outbreak of foodborne illnesses. No details are available as yet.

Norway: The Norwegian Institute of Public Health is investigating an increase in the incidence of Salmonella Typhimurium infections as compared to the past three years. Cases have been reported from all over the country and are distributed across all age groups.

Canada

Food Safety Recall: I-D Foods Corporation recalls Al’Fez brand Natural Tahini (160g; Batch codes 3354 & 4004; Best before 2025 JN 20 & 2025 JL 04, respectively) due to Salmonella contamination.

Food Safety Recall: Danone Canada recalls multiple varieties and flavours of Silk brnd and Great Value brand plant-based refrigerated beverages due to Listeria monocytogenes contamination. Please refer to the recall notice for a complete list of affected products.

United Kingdom and Ireland

Allergy Alert (Ireland): FSAI advises that True Natural Goodness Giant Cous Cous (500g; All batches and all best-before dates; Product of USA) contains undeclared wheat (gluten).

Allergy Alert (Ireland): Marks & Spencer recalls M&S Chocolate Cornflake Mini Bites (180g; Best before 06 August 2024) due to undeclared hazelnuts (nuts), oats (gluten) and wheat (gluten).

Allergy Alert (UK): Marks & Spencer recalls M&S Chocolate Cornflake Mini Bites (180g; Best before 06 August 2024) due to undeclared hazelnuts (nuts), oats (gluten) and wheat (gluten).

Allergy Alert (UK): Japan Food Express Ltd recalls Daisho Hakata Ramen Noodle Tonkotsu (188g; Best before end of December 2024) due to undeclared sesame.

Food Safety Recall (Ireland): Industry recalls Etoile de Provence Banon AOP raw milk goats’ cheese (100g; Best before 12/07/2024 & 19/07/2024; Product of France) due to Yersinia enterocolitica contamination.

Australia and New Zealand

Food Safety Recall (Australia): Jun Pacific Corporation Pty Ltd recalls Morigana Manna Bolo (34g; All best before markings and batch codes) due to contamination with foreign biological material.

Food Safety Recall (Australia): AB World Foods Pty Ltd recalls Al’Fez Natural Tahini Paste (160g; Best before 06 2025) due to Salmonella contamination.

Food Safety Recall (New Zealand): AB World Foods Pty Ltd recalls Al’Fez Natural Tahini Paste (160g; Batch code 3355; Best before 06 2025; Product of Poland) due to possible Salmonella contamination.
